Ever since she gave birth to her three kittens, Myrtille has become skeletal!

1. She is exceptionally thin...

Myrtille is a three-year-old cat who has given birth to three kittens. Riddled with worms and smothered in fleas, poor Myrtille is particularly skinny! Unfortunately, we haven't yet managed to catch her to get rid of the parasites...

2. She lives outside, relying on her instincts...

Myrtille lives outdoors, somewhere between a village and a forest, sadly with no shelter to protect her. She survives in the wilderness along with her kittens...

3. Canned food would help her regain weight

To effectively replenish her nutrients and gain weight, Myrtille will need canned food. The benefit of a diet so rich in protein and vitamins would provide her daily comfort!

Gradually, it'll become smoother for us to approach her, in order to delouse her and provide the best possible care and support.

4. Hundreds of tomcats are counting on us...!

This year, we have had a lot of births. Many kittens were sick, causing expenses which we struggle to cover...

In fact, we are already catering to the needs of 350 animals, including around 200 stray cats! Between the food, blankets, treatments and kennels... we are stretched thin!
